Output 8f661387f6eb3dd29a89b978ebffc3dbc5a66d040ce59490b113aabac6702d48:21
- value
- 7663271
- script pubkey
- OP_0 OP_PUSHBYTES_20 f520aef2c03e0d368c337a956d914df7ae2ceaba
- address
- bc1q75s2aukq8cxndrpn022kmy2d77hze646ln6gx8
- transaction
- 8f661387f6eb3dd29a89b978ebffc3dbc5a66d040ce59490b113aabac6702d48